This Penetration Tester Position Involves the Following Responsibilities:
The Penetration Tester will work with the Vulnerability Assessment team on penetration test efforts. Contribute to developing and implementing tools for analysis/detection and early warning of weaknesses or possible incidents building on methodologies as promulgated by NIST, ISO, etc. to ensure useful, measurable, and repeatable methods applied to quantifying risk.
- Support monitoring, testing, and troubleshooting of cybersecurity issues.
- Select, install, and configure, security testing platforms and tools or develop tools and procedures for vulnerability assessments and penetration tests.
- Contribute to application of FISMA compliance mechanisms, including NIST SP 800 series, with the addition of sound methodologies in lieu of weakly-defined and subjective scores.
- Perform vulnerability assessments using automated tools (Metasploit, Nmap, Nessus, Burp Suite, etc.)
- Experience with DISA STIGs or similar secure configuration guidelines.
- Perform manual penetration tests and validation of vulnerability scan results.
- Develop automation/scripts for replicating vulnerability validation and penetration tests.
- Devise plans and scenarios for various types of penetration tests.
